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 617 1723 6969849 664768
04256966 552
04256966 552
348 750320 3864
All about undefined
Interested in learning more?
04256966 552
348 750320 3864
See more
3959440 0668
901 4267753 6305 636757879
See more
664526 288607
26 4187 177002726 077436323 4708276544
See more